HIP 31107 is a B-type (Blue-White) star.

At a distance of roughly 1,109 light-years, HIP 31107 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 31107 is classified as a spectral class B star (B-type (Blue-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 31107 has an apparent magnitude of +6.64,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its blue h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of -0.119.
